Megan M. Dewdney is a scholar working on Plant Science, Cell Biology and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Megan M. Dewdney has authored 102 papers receiving a total of 794 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 93 papers in Plant Science, 55 papers in Cell Biology and 12 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Megan M. Dewdney’s work include Plant Pathogens and Fungal Diseases (55 papers), Plant Physiology and Cultivation Studies (45 papers) and Banana Cultivation and Research (30 papers). Megan M. Dewdney is often cited by papers focused on Plant Pathogens and Fungal Diseases (55 papers), Plant Physiology and Cultivation Studies (45 papers) and Banana Cultivation and Research (30 papers). Megan M. Dewdney coll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and China. Megan M. Dewdney's co-authors include Odile Carisse, Natália A. Peres, Nan‐Yi Wang, Jeffrey A. Rollins, Timothy C. Paulitz, Guoqing Chen, Alan R. Biggs, Kevin D. Hyde, Hongye Li and Feng Huang and has published in prestigious journals such as Frontiers in Microbiology, Sensors and Phytopathology.
